The goal of the study presented in this thesis is to evaluate the advantages and drawbacks of using powder technology in the design of the iron core of small claw-pole electric motors. The use of soft magnetic composites (SMC) and compaction technology allows the creation of complex 3D iron cores. Design of plastic bonded … WebHigh flux High flux cores consists of 50% iron and 50% nickel powder and i s used when very high saturation, 1.5 T, is needed [20]. The losses is higher comparedto MPP but …
